  • Ensemble Dark Horse: Ellana was one of the most popular characters in La QuĂȘte and Les Mondes, and later got a trilogy of her own with Le Pacte.
  • Jerkass Woobie: Elea 'Ril Morienval, with a heavy emphasis on the Jerkass part. She had an awful backstory, with her being led on for years by Altan with promises he was sick of his wife (and Elea's rival) Elicia, only for Altan to abandon her when she became pregnant with their child. Elea was going to move on with her life and raise her daughter, only for her pregnancy to suffer severe complications. When she cried out for Altan to help her, he cruelly refused because it would look suspicious. When her daughter died but she survived, Elea became inconsolable and vowed revenge on the 'Gil Sayans by any means necessary, though her means eventually became siding with a race of human-eating monsters and later trying to destroy all of Gwendalavir with an Eldritch Abomination.
  • Moral Event Horizon: Elea kidnapping and medically experimenting on Ewilan for months until she became catatonic destroyed any chance at her gaining any sort of redemption. Plus, the same book reveals she did the same with younger children (including a baby), and contrary to with Ewilan she didn't have any personal grievance against them. Even when she is given a sympathetic backstory afterwards, it is meant to contextualize her actions, not justify them.
  • Strangled by the Red String: Mathieu and Siam. The two have absolutely nothing in common, yet Mathieu falls in love with Siam at first sight and from then on attempts to court her. Mathieu is a Non-Action Guy, while Siam can charitably be described as Ax-Crazy and shows open disdain for anyone who can't fight, yet falls for Mathieu anyways. After the first trilogy Pierre Boltero Deconstructed this aspect of their relationship, showing the pair had an extremely rocky relationship with the series ending with them broken up and unlikely to get back together due to their fundamental differences being too strong.
  • Villain Decay: When first introduced, the Ts'lichs are described as the "ultimate predators", both skilled at fighting and Illustration, and Edwin is the only person to have ever defeated them. As the story goes on, he's able to defeat more and more at the same time, to the point of slaying four of them at the same time in the final book of La QuĂȘte. During the climax of Les Mondes, the last survivors of their race get slain ridiculously fast, not only by Edwin, but also by Siam, Duom, and Ellana, who each get to kill one.
